By Leke Beecroft and Jane Onwubuyah
*Dome finally sits atop structure without props.
*Dr Enenche says Next "Worship and Wonders Night" scheduled for 31 August to hold in New facility.


The magnificent dome roof which sits atop the awe-inspiring Glory Dome has finally been placed. This is an intricate engineering structure which was put together by coupling 21,800 pieces of metal fabrications together. Its parts were built by Geometrica in USA but assembled on site by Nigerians. The length of the building is about 300m. Any delay in the completion of the structure is due to the process and never funding as some would like to believe. The workers on site testify that they can’t explain themselves what’s going on as this could only be God at work. The structure was initially billed to take 75,000 and as construction went on, it was realized that it could hold up to 85,000 but with some adjustments factored in a few places, its capacity will be 100,000 on completion.
The auditorium has no single visible pillar supporting it as the pillars are embedded in the walls while the beauty of the suspended doom roof is more obvious. At the time of the visit, pictures of the inside were not allowed to be taken but it is a view better beheld than explained.
Other facilities already on ground are the secondary school, event center, the Garden, Housing Estate building prototype, streetlights and ringroad to complement the tarred road.
Inspite of the level of work ongoing at the site, no single mention of ‘building offering’ was made in any of the 6 overflooded services on Sunday and on further inquiries from a worshipper at the Church, it was gathered that building offerings are never collected or requested during services.
It will be recalled that on 14th September 2014, Bishop Oyedepo was invited for the groundbreaking ceremony of The The Lord’s Garden at Airport Road, Abuja.
Since the start of this project in 2014, Work has not been halted for a day for ANY reason whatsoever and work goes on day and night as was witnessed during visit to the site.
Also gathered was that workers are paid as at when due. There are no ‘sorry, please come back tomorrow' to the workers. Engineers, technicians, horticulturists, gardeners, welders, carpenters and infact everybody who are working at the same time are paid as at when due.
In a short while from now, Christendom will gather to celebrate the Glory of God at the Glory Dome.
